The status and income of such a man would have depended upon the type of work he did. A man skilled enough to build a great castle or cathedral would have been able to command a very high salary and might well have worked internationally as his services were sought by kings, nobles, and clergy. In addition to overseeing the work, the Master would plan the building, using the principles of geometry known to only a select few, and would also design doorways and windows.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>He was much more than just a stone cutter and would have \u2018employed and instructed\u2019 his workers in their tasks. Just as today we say the Worshipful Master of a Lodge is placed in the East to employ and instruct the brethren in Freemasonry.
